
The Chair of the Agrarian Issues Committee, Gela Samkharauli held a meeting with the members of the Committee on Rural Affairs of the Seimas of Lithuania and deliberated on the EU integration of Georgia and the fulfillment of the 9-point recommendations.
The emphasis was placed on the Georgia-Lithuania cooperation in the education and agrarian spheres.
“We thanked our Lithuanian colleagues for supporting the territorial integrity and EU integration of Georgia. Their experience in this regard is of utmost value for us. Their support serves as an aid to some extent to get through the path that Lithuania has already covered to the EU and NATO membership. Our colleagues asked about the relevant processes in the country, including the Draft Law on Transparency of Foreign Influence, on which our response was comprehensive. Lithuania facilitates the education of Georgian students at various universities of Europe, for which we are highly grateful”, - G. Samkharauli noted.
The parties touched upon the cooperation in sector spheres.
“We undertake twinning programs in the agrarian sector with active engagement of Lithuania. Their experience in terms of cooperatives is significant. We overviewed the challenges that our country encounters, including the scarcity of land and low yield. We aspire to intensify our cooperation in this direction and share their experience”, - G. Samkharauli added.
The meeting was attended by the members of the Agrarian Issues Committee and the Chair of the Sector Economy and Economic Policy Committee, David Songulashvili.
